God Bless you Ashia! I’m glad there were a couple of sisters to give you a little advice on what to tell your children when they ask about “daddy”. I agree 100%, never say anything bad about their father in front of them or even if you believe them to be out of earshot. Just keep your comments to yourself and let them know how much you love and care for them. Let them know that although the relationship did not work out that in no way diminishes the love that you both have for them.
